WebJul 12, 2013 · Toothpaste (and more professional polishers, like Brasso) is able to remove scratches from things like CDs and lenses because it has very small micro-abrasives that (when combined with force) smooth-out the area around the scratch. WebBrasso has been used on Lego minifigures to remove markings. Brasso has been used by watch enthusiasts to polish scratches out of acrylic crystals on watches. Brasso has been successfully used to take minor … WebThe brasso is removing part of the plastic from the disc not adding to it. You are actually scraping away part of the CD which makes the existing scratches smaller. After 15 …
